Assam Science and Technology University set the Assam CEE 2026 eligibility criteria defining the minimum requirements for those interested in appearing for the exam. The CEE eligibility criteria states that you must have completed your 12th from a recognised educational board with Physics, Chemistry, and Mathematics as compulsory subjects. The Assam CEE eligibility criteria also states that you are required to be a minimum of 17 years old in order to appear for Assam CEE 2026 exam.
The eligibility requirements cover a number of important topics, including age, nationality, residence status, and educational background. Candidates must have earned a minimum aggregate percentage as required by ASTU and passed their 10+2 exam with Physics, Chemistry, and Mathematics (PCM) as required subjects from an accredited board. Furthermore, the applicant's age must be within the range given and generally correspond with the standards established by the Assam Directorate of Technical Education.
The domicile criterion, which stipulates that applicants must be Assamese permanent residents in order to be eligible for admission under the state quota, is an essential component of the eligibility procedure. During the application and counseling phases, proof of residency and other pertinent certifications are needed. According to government laws, the eligibility standards also consider category-based relaxations for applicants from reserved categories, including SC, ST, and OBC. If you meet the requirements and provide valid proof of your category, you can claim your reservation under certain categories. The table below outlines the detailed reservation policy for Assam CEE 2026 eligibility criteria:-
Category | Reservation |
|---|---|
Scheduled Castes (SC) | 7% |
Scheduled Tribes (Plains) (ST(P) | 10% |
Scheduled Tribes (Hills) (ST(H)) | 5% |
Other Backward Classes (including MOBC) | As per the latest Government Rules |
Tea garden labor community (TGLC) | 1 seat per college |
Ex-tea garden labor community (Ex TGLC) | 1 seat per college |
Son, and Daughter of Ex-Serviceman | 1 seat per college |
Other Reserved Seats:
Category | Reservation |
|---|---|
Child / Grandchild of any freedom fighter (including both paternal & maternal) | 2 seats in AEC and 2 seats in JEC and 1 seat in JIST, Jorhat in a specific branch. (Out of these seats, one seat is reserved for SC/ST/OBC/MOBC.) |
Physically Challenged | 3% of the total intake capability of the college |
NCC | 1 seat per college |
Sportsman | 1 seat per college |
Moran/Motak communities | 1 seat per college |
